Partner and Pennsylvania Litigation Attorney
John Aitchison is an Attorney in Kanner & Pintaluga’s Pennsylvania Litigation Team.
John possesses extensive trial experience including conducting over 60 civil jury trials, demonstrating a strong ability to achieve favorable outcomes in complex matters.
Prior to joining Kanner & Pintaluga, John was an ADA with Montgomery County, general practice litigation, and plaintiffs’ PI litigation.
John received a B.A. from the State University of New York at Albany. He completed his J.D. at Temple University. While at Temple, John received many awards:
- First Year Scholar Award – 2005
- Member of National Trial Team – Fall 2006- Spring 2008 Coached by Edward D. Ohlbaum
- Winner of National Association of Criminal Defense Lawyers (NACDL) Trial Competition – 2006
- Winner of Cathy Bennett Overall Best Advocate Award from National Association of Criminal Defense Lawyers (NACDL) – 2006
- Two (2) time Winner of Regional Trial Competition – 2007, 2008
- Finalist at the National Trial Competition – 2007
- Two (2) time winner of Lewis F. Powell Medal For Excellence in Advocacy from American College of Trial Lawyers – 2007, 2008
- Two (2) time winner of Murray S. Love Memorial Award for Excellence in Trial Advocacy from Pennsylvania Trial Lawyers Association – 2007, 2008
- Graduation Honors
- Andrew Gay Award – 2008
- Outstanding Performance in the Field of Evidence Award from Technical Advisory Service for Attorneys – 2008
- James J. Manderino Award for Trial Advocacy from Philadelphia Trial Lawyers Association – 2008
